Consider this, if you are a home owner of at least a year or so, in most parts of the country you are sitting on a tidy paper profit, probably facilitated by a big mortgage. Nice. For those who were trying to get into the home ownership for the first time, it has been a nightmare. But now, that home equity may be cracking. Worth remembering that former prime minister John Howard once said no one ever complained to him that the price of their house was going up.
